Notre Dame Takes Significant Step with Al Washington Appointment

Notre Dame has taken a significant step forward in its coaching strategy with the appointment of Al Washington as its new linebackers coach. This move comes in the wake of Max Bullough’s departure to Michigan State, where he will serve as co-defensive coordinator.
Al Washington’s Appointment
Washington, a notable figure in college football coaching, will officially step into his new role immediately. His promotion reflects the trust and confidence the Notre Dame coaching staff has in his abilities. Washington previously served as the defensive run game coordinator and line coach for the Fighting Irish.
Career Development
Al Washington’s career spans nearly two decades. His coaching versatility includes roles in various defensive positions as well as overseeing special teams. He also coached the running backs at Boston College from 2013 to 2015. Washington was a candidate for the head coaching position at Boston College, highlighting his qualifications in the field.
Notre Dame Linebacking Corps
Washington inherits a talented linebacking unit poised for success. Notre Dame is expecting to return key players such as:
- Drayk Bowen, the captain
- Jaiden Ausberry, a consistent playmaker
- Kyngstonn Viliamu-Asa, returning from injury
- Madden Faraimo, a standout from the 2025 signing class
In addition, there are optimistic indications that former five-star prospect Jaylen Sneed will return for his final year.
Upcoming Recruiting Classes
Notre Dame’s recruiting efforts continue to impress. The program’s 2026 signing class is currently ranked among the top five nationally. This class includes renowned linebackers Thomas Davis Jr. and Jakobe Clapper, both of whom are highly anticipated additions.
Future Coaching Moves
With Washington’s promotion, Notre Dame’s coaching staff is now searching for someone to fill his previous role. Defensive coordinator Chris Ash and head coach Marcus Freeman are actively exploring various candidates, including options from the NFL.
